【GitHub每日速递 20260519】谁还花钱买电子签?这款开源工具DocuSeal,PDF表单+在线签名全搞定,一键部署超简单

0 阅读8分钟

谁还花钱买电子签?这款开源工具DocuSeal,PDF表单+在线签名全搞定,一键部署超简单

docuseal 是一个用于创建和管理电子签名表单的开源工具。简单讲,它能让你像用纸质合同一样方便地在线签署文件,无需复杂操作。适用人群:需要无纸化签约的中小企业、开发者和个人用户。

项目地址:github.com/docusealco/…

主要语言:Ruby

stars: 15.5k

image

DocuSeal是一个开源平台,用于安全高效地进行数字文档的签署和处理。以下是对该平台的详细介绍:

主要功能

  • PDF表单字段构建:提供所见即所得(WYSIWYG)的PDF表单字段构建器,有12种字段类型,如签名、日期、文件、复选框等。
  • 多提交者支持:每份文档可设置多个提交者。
  • 自动化邮件:通过SMTP实现自动化邮件发送。
  • 文件存储:支持将文件存储在本地磁盘、AWS S3、Google Storage、Azure Cloud等。
  • 自动电子签名:可自动进行PDF电子签名,并能对签名进行验证。
  • 用户管理:方便对用户进行管理。
  • 移动优化:界面经过优化,适合在移动设备上使用。
  • 多语言支持:UI支持7种语言,签署支持14种语言。
  • 集成功能:提供API和Webhooks,便于与其他系统集成。
  • 快速部署:可以在几分钟内完成部署。

专业版功能

  • 品牌定制:支持设置公司标志和白标。
  • 用户角色管理:可对不同用户设置不同角色。
  • 自动提醒:能自动发送提醒信息。
  • 短信验证:通过短信进行邀请和身份验证。
  • 条件字段和公式:支持设置条件字段和使用公式。
  • 批量发送:可通过导入CSV、XLSX电子表格进行批量发送。
  • 单点登录:支持SSO / SAML。
  • 模板创建:可通过HTML API、PDF或DOCX和字段标签API创建模板。
  • 嵌入式表单:提供React、Vue、Angular和JavaScript版本的嵌入式签名表单和文档表单构建器。

部署方式

  • 云平台部署:支持在Heroku、Railway、DigitalOcean、Render等云平台上一键部署。
  • Docker部署:使用Docker命令 docker run --name docuseal -p 3000:3000 -v.:/data docuseal/docuseal 即可运行。默认使用SQLite数据库,也可通过设置 DATABASE_URL 环境变量使用PostgreSQL或MySQL数据库。
  • Docker Compose部署:先下载 docker-compose.yml 文件,然后通过 sudo HOST=your-domain-name.com docker compose up 命令在自定义域名下通过https运行应用。

应用场景

  • 企业集成:可将无缝的文档签署功能集成到企业的Web或移动应用中,适用于银行、医疗、运输、房地产、电子商务、KYC、CRM等行业。
  • 电子文档处理:帮助企业降低电子文档开发和处理的成本,同时确保安全和符合当地电子文档法律。

工具

  • 签名生成器:可在线生成签名。
  • 在线签署文档:支持在线签署文档。
  • 在线填充PDF:方便在线填充PDF文件。

封神级AI编码辅助神器!省20-40%令牌成本,自动切换免费/低价模型,对接40+服务商全程不卡壳

9router 是一个基于 JavaScript 实现的轻量级前端路由库。简单讲,它帮助开发者在单页面应用中实现页面跳转和 URL 管理,无需刷新页面即可切换视图。适用人群:前端开发人员,尤其是需要快速搭建 SPA 路由功能的 JavaScript 开发者。

项目地址:github.com/decolua/9ro…

主要语言:JavaScript

stars: 4.4k

image

核心功能

  • 节省令牌:集成 RTK Token Saver 技术,可自动压缩工具输出内容,每次请求节省 20 - 40% 的输入令牌;Caveman 模式能让大语言模型以简洁方式回复,最多节省 65% 的输出令牌。
  • 智能路由:具备 3 层智能回退机制,当订阅服务配额耗尽时,自动切换到廉价模型,预算不足时再切换到免费模型,确保编码过程不间断。
  • 配额管理:实时跟踪各提供商的令牌消耗情况和配额重置倒计时,帮助用户充分利用订阅服务。
  • 格式转换:支持 OpenAI、Claude、Gemini 等多种格式之间的无缝转换,可与任何支持自定义 OpenAI 端点的 CLI 工具兼容。
  • 多账户支持:允许为每个提供商添加多个账户,实现负载均衡和冗余备份。
  • 自动令牌刷新:OAuth 令牌会在过期前自动刷新,无需手动重新登录。
  • 自定义组合:用户可以创建无限的模型组合,根据自身需求定制回退策略。
  • 请求日志记录:开启调试模式后,可记录完整的请求和响应日志,方便排查集成问题。
  • 云同步:支持在不同设备间同步配置,确保在任何设备上都能使用相同的设置。
  • 使用分析:跟踪令牌使用情况、成本和趋势,帮助用户优化 AI 使用成本。
  • 灵活部署:支持在本地主机、VPS、Docker 和 Cloudflare Workers 等多种环境中部署。

优势

  • 节省成本:通过 RTK 技术和智能回退机制,降低令牌使用量,优先使用免费和廉价模型,减少用户在 AI 服务上的开支。
  • 提高效率:避免因配额耗尽和速率限制导致的编码中断,确保开发过程的流畅性。
  • 兼容性强:与多种 AI 编码工具和 40 多个 AI 提供商、100 多个模型兼容,为用户提供了广泛的选择。
  • 易于使用:提供直观的仪表盘,方便用户管理提供商、模型组合和查看使用情况;提供详细的设置指南和视频教程,降低用户的使用门槛。

应用场景

  • 已有订阅用户:对于已经订阅了 Claude Code、Codex 等服务的用户,可通过 9Router 充分利用订阅配额,在配额耗尽时自动切换到廉价或免费模型,避免因配额不足而影响工作。
  • 预算有限用户:对于无法承担高额订阅费用的用户,可使用 Kiro AI、OpenCode Free 等免费模型,结合 RTK 技术节省令牌,实现零成本的 AI 编码。
  • 对稳定性要求高的用户:对于需要 24/7 不间断编码的用户,可通过设置多层回退机制,确保在任何情况下都能获得稳定的 AI 服务。
  • 希望在 OpenClaw 中使用免费 AI 的用户:可通过 9Router 连接免费模型,在 WhatsApp、Telegram 等消息应用中使用免费的 AI 助手。

快速开始

  • 全局安装:使用 npm install -g 9router 进行全局安装,然后运行 9router 命令,仪表盘将在 http://localhost:20128 打开。
  • 连接免费提供商:在仪表盘的“Providers”中连接 Kiro AI 或 OpenCode Free。
  • 在 CLI 工具中使用:将 CLI 工具的端点设置为 http://localhost:20128/v1,API 密钥从仪表盘复制,选择合适的模型即可开始使用。

支持的工具和提供商

  • CLI 工具:支持 Claude Code、OpenClaw、Codex、OpenCode、Cursor、Antigravity、Cline 等多种 AI 编码工具。
  • 提供商:支持 OAuth 提供商(如 Claude Code、GitHub 等)、免费提供商(如 Kiro AI、OpenCode Free 等)和 40 多个 API 密钥提供商(如 OpenAI、Anthropic 等)。

部署方式

  • VPS 部署:克隆仓库,安装依赖,配置环境变量,使用 npm run start 启动服务,也可使用 PM2 进行管理。
  • Docker 部署:构建 Docker 镜像,使用 docker run 命令启动容器,并通过环境变量注入配置。

技术栈

  • 运行时:Node.js 20+
  • 框架:Next.js 16
  • UI:React 19 + Tailwind CSS 4
  • 数据库:LowDB(基于 JSON 文件)
  • 流式传输:Server-Sent Events (SSE)
  • 认证:OAuth 2.0 (PKCE) + JWT + API Keys

常见问题解答

  • 仪表盘显示高成本的原因:仪表盘显示的成本是基于使用付费 API 的估算,仅用于参考,实际成本取决于用户使用的提供商。
  • 是否会被 9Router 收费:9Router 是免费的开源软件,不会向用户收费,用户只需直接向提供商支付费用。
  • 免费提供商是否真的无限使用:Kiro AI、OpenCode Free 和 Vertex AI 等免费提供商确实提供免费且无隐藏费用的服务。
  • 如何最小化 AI 成本:优先使用免费模型组合,必要时添加廉价备份,最后使用订阅服务。
  • 使用量突然增加的应对方法:9Router 的智能回退机制可自动切换到廉价或免费模型,避免意外费用。

原文:mp.weixin.qq.com/s/wuWpCAHnG…

欢迎关注g*h:AI Tech研习社

关注g*h,后台回复【OpenClaw完全使用手册】,领取OpenClaw完全使用手册.pdf学习资料,更多学习资源敬请期待。